有许多时候,会发现我们会发现有些网站会有实时访问人数,学了jsp的一些知识,试着做下这个这个模仿
嘿嘿,直接贴代码,很简单的~~~
<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%>
<%!
//定义全局变量
int j=0;
%>
<%
//每次访问自动+1
j++;
%>
<%!
String parseToHtml(int num){
StringBuffer sb=new StringBuffer("");
//将数字类型转为字符型,以便截取与拼接操作
String numstr=num+"";
for(int i=0;i<numstr.length();i++){
String n=numstr.substring(i,i+1);
sb.append("<img src=\"images/"+n+".gif\" /> ");
}
return sb.toString();
}
%>
当前访问次数:<%=parseToHtml(j) %>
效果图:
这个会在每次被访问这一网站数字就会加1,并且,替换成图片显示。
但是由于这个并未操作数据库,这个值只是在服务器里保存的,因此当重启服务器时该值会自动清零的。。。。